Hey everyone got a find today we had a set of mercedes wheels that we took to the scrap yard to day at work. the man who bought the car wanted different rims and they were sitting around. so the boss told one of the techs to take them to the scrap yard, anyway the boss let me keep the tires they had 10 miles on them brand new car. The size is 245/40 zr17 the sppedrating is Y has anyone run this size on there GTO. im wondering cause there 5% sikinner i know it will sit lower and the gap will be bigger and the speedo will be off a couple mph.there michialin piolt sports and free
Thanks Eric




Hummina
08-15-2006, 03:23 PM
theyll work fine. just the speedo will be off 3.8%, so when your speedo says 60, youll really be going 57.7
